The South Korean (Z)-3-hexen-1-ol market has garnered increasing attention owing to its pivotal role in flavor, fragrance, and aroma industries. As a key green leaf volatile compound, (Z)-3-hexen-1-ol’s unique olfactory profile and natural occurrence position it as a vital ingredient across multiple sectors. Market Sizing, Growth Estimates, and CAGR Projections

Based on current industry reports, the South Korean (Z)-3-hexen-1-ol market was valued at approximately USD 45 million in 2023. The market’s growth is driven by escalating demand in flavor enhancement, natural fragrance formulations, and organic product segments. Assuming a conservative compound annual growth rate (CAGR) of 6.5% over the next five years, the market is projected to reach USD 64 million by 2028.

Key assumptions underpinning this projection include:

  • Steady expansion of the natural and organic product sectors in South Korea and neighboring Asia-Pacific markets.
  • Increasing consumer preference for plant-based and eco-friendly ingredients.
  • Technological advancements reducing extraction and synthesis costs.
  • Growing regulatory support for natural flavor and fragrance ingredients.

Major End-User Segments & Use Cases

  • Flavor & Fragrance Industry:

    Utilized for natural aroma profiles in perfumes, air fresheners, and flavoring agents in beverages and confectionery.

  • Food & Beverage:

    Incorporated into organic snack formulations, herbal teas, and functional foods to impart fresh, green notes.

  • Cosmetics & Personal Care:

    Used in natural skincare products, deodorants, and hair care formulations emphasizing eco-friendly ingredients.
